Deern
German
Etymology
Via German Low German Deern, from Middle Low German dêrne (“girl”), from Old Saxon thiorna, from Proto-Germanic *þewernǭ, which is the same word as Dirne (“girl; whore”).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/deːɐ̯n/, /dɛːɐ̯n/
Noun
Deern f (genitive Deern, plural Deerns)
